Material Types◦ Nickel, Tool Steel, Stainless Steel◦ Welding Rod Diameter: 0.005 – 0.025 inches

Machine Specs◦ Average Power: 200 Watts◦ Welding Spot Diameter/Melting Path: 0.2 – 2.0 mm◦ Arm Deflection/Working Distance: 1500 mm

Mold & Grain Repair

We offer In-House Laser Welding with the Alpha Laser ALFlak200 to repair cracks, grain re-work and countermeasures forhard to electroform geometry.

Mobile Repair ServiceTo meet a growing demand for On-Site Service, we invested in anew Mobile Repair unit offering a wide range of services for alltypes of tools & molds.◦ Laser Welding◦ Mold & Grain Repair

Advantages:◦ Quality◦ High Precision in Hard-to-Reach Areas◦ Low Heat Input = Minimal to Zero Distortion◦ Same Day Quality Confirmation

◦ Fast, Cost-Effective Repairs◦ Reduce Cost & Risk of Part Bank◦ Reduce Scrap Quantities◦ Reduce Need for Secondary Finishing Processes ◦ Reduce Tool & Die Bench Time◦ Eliminate Time & Cost for Tool Shipping

Electroform Nickel Plating

11 Plating Tanks up to 13’ L x 10’ W x 6’ H & 1 Etching Tank

FET ENGINEERING, INC. | PUBLISHED APRIL, 2015 | NON-CONFIDENTIAL 18

Why Nickel? It has mechanical properties close to steelwith effective corrosion & thermal shock resistance withexcellent release properties for forming PVC and otherpolymers.

The Electroform Nickel Platingprocess enables us to achieve0.05 – 0.1 microns of detailaccuracy in grain patterns.

Slush Tooling

We utilize custom piping & rivets to evenly distribute HOT AIR and heat to the tool.

FET ENGINEERING, INC. | PUBLISHED APRIL, 2015 | NON-CONFIDENTIAL 20

Stainless piping & copper finson this double cavity HOT SANDmold increase productionvolume & create uniform heatdistribution.

Our fabrication team has developed anintricate piping process for HOT OIL lines thatguarantee even heat distribution throughoutthe mold for high quality skins. We have thecapability to test for secure line connectionson new and repair tools.

Vacuum Form Tooling & TrialsFET is on the cutting edge of tooling technology with our Maac 75S Vacuum Forming machine. We can build Male, Female IMG & IMGL tools with air assist.

We can run prototype, trial & low volume production parts.

FET ENGINEERING, INC. | PUBLISHED APRIL, 2015 | NON-CONFIDENTIAL 21

Female IMGL

Male

Female IMG

Vacuum Form Trials -Machine Specs◦ Platen/Mold Size 84” x 60”◦ Clamp Frame Opening 86” x 62”◦ Top Platen Stroke 36”, Bottom

Platen Stroke 70”◦ Top & Bottom Platen “Daylight” 6”◦ Sheet-Line 100”◦ Pressure Assist Capability 30 PSI◦ Platen Weight 3,500 lbs @ 12 IPS

(Inches per second) or 7,000 lbs @ 6 IPS

◦ Material Sheet Size 88” x 64”◦ Pre-programming of forming

techniques◦ Quartz Oven: Lower 54 zones,

Upper 110 zones & 1 Infrared Heat Sensor

◦ Forming Functions – Both Top & Bottom◦ Vacuum◦ Plug Assist◦ Billow Cavity Mold◦ Snap Back◦ Billow Male Mold

◦ Vacuum System equipped with◦ 3, 2” Vacuum Valves◦ 3, 2” Ball Valves – Servo Controlled –

Platen Position & Time◦ 4, 1” Air Valves◦ 4, 1” Ball Valves – Servo Controlled –

Platen Position & Time

◦ 2, 35 Gallon per Minute Water Heaters/Pumps

◦ Platen motors equipped with absolute encoders for position & speed control

◦ Lower platen tilt to worker◦ Adjustable clamp frame – can be

moved during forming process

Gauges & JigsOur team can design, fabricate and modify all types of Fixtures & Jigsto gauge your parts, hold pieces for operational procedures or trimexcess material ensuring accuracy and quality every time.◦ Fixtures: Check, Welding, Laser & Assembly◦ Jigs: Vibration, Automation, Seamless, Holding & Poke Yoke

We can build Attribute or SPC Variable gauges using high qualitymaterials for construction◦ Composites, Bakelite, Resin, Steel, Aluminum, etc.

We provide certification of gauges within desired part tolerances.◦ 0.05 to 0.1 mm on Datums & SPC’s◦ 0.1 to 0.15 mm for Trim & Form
